What is Prop Firm Trading? Proprietary trading, or prop trading, allows traders to use a firm’s capital instead of their own to trade various financial instruments. In exchange, traders earn a share of the profits they generate.

This model is ideal for talented traders who lack the personal funds to scale up. Prop firms offer access to larger trading capital, professional-grade platforms, structured evaluations, and often, training resources.

Whether you’re into forex, stocks, or crypto, prop trading firms have made it possible to trade remotely via digital platforms, opening the door to global participation.

Key Concepts of Prop Trading Access to Capital: Once you pass an evaluation phase, many prop firms provide account sizes ranging from $50,000 to $500,000+.

Evaluation Challenges: Most firms require you to pass a challenge—a test that assesses your profitability, risk management, and consistency over a specific period.

Risk Rules: Prop firms impose strict guidelines on daily losses, maximum drawdowns, and overall trading behavior. Violating these rules can lead to disqualification—discipline is non-negotiable.

Profit Sharing: Traders usually keep 70% to 90% of the profits, with the firm retaining the rest. Some firms also offer scaling programs to increase account size based on performance.

Trading Platforms: Popular platforms include MetaTrader 4/5, cTrader, and TradingView.

Market Access: Depending on the firm, you can trade forex, indices, commodities,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ies.
